What is the advantage of AC vs DC?

The major advantage that AC electricity has over DC electricity is that AC voltages can be readily transformed to higher or lower voltage levels, while it is difficult to do that with DC voltages. Since high voltages are more efficient for sending electricity great distances, AC electricity has an advantage over DC.

What is the main advantage of DC?

The biggest advantage of DC electricity is that it is easier to store than AC electricity, especially on a small scale. Storing electricity when it is made, for use later when it is needed, is a critical concept for a hybrid independent power plant.

How does alternating current differ from direct current?

Difference Between Alternating Current and Direct Current. Direction: Alternating current reverses, the direction periodically, i.e. now the current flows from the phase to neutral means, during second half cycle (negative) the current flows from neutral to phase, in direct current do not reverse the direction.

Why is AC more efficient than DC?

Since high voltages are more efficient for sending electricity great distances, AC electricity has an advantage over DC. This is because the high voltages from the power station can be easily reduced to a safer voltage for use in the house. Changing voltages is done by the use of a transformer.
